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The development of Immune Checkpoint Blockade (ICB) is a revolution in medical oncology as ICB have changed the standard treatments of several metastatic tumor types. However, the response rate to ICB is low, and the biological bases for this response heterogeneity are poorly understood.

In the frame of Immunosup study, we will collect blood (at baseline, post infusion of ICB n°2/4/8 and at progression) and tumor samples (optional: at baseline and progression) from patients with locally advanced or metastatic cancer, treated with ICB, in order to determine if the dynamics of immunosuppressive actors (MDSC, TReg, Immunosuppressive cytokines) predicts response to these immunotherapies.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Age \> 18 years
* Diagnosis of locally advanced or metastatic solid tumor or lymphoma treated with Immune check blockade
* Signed informed consent
* Affiliated to(or beneficiary of) the French Social Security

Exclusion Criteria

* Pregnant or breastfeeding woman or woman who does not apply effective contraception
* Emergency
* Vulnerable person or unable to provide informed consent
* Emergency
* Person unable to comply with required study follow up
* Contraindication to the study procedure
